Transaction 3063c6e59a961d8683c4aa80152e74e1780bdf27798206ceca132ec398117446
1 Input
1 Output
-
3063c6e59a961d8683c4aa80152e74e1780bdf27798206ceca132ec398117446:0
- value
- 5769
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c570f3cc882eaf56741b275405c4fe813446cbb
- address
- bc1q83ts70xgst402e6pkf65qhz0aqf5gm9mumjkfk